The differences between inspectors general and operations inspectors can be seen in a few details. Each job has different responsibilities and duties. Additionally, an inspector general has an average salary of $48,026, which is higher than the $29,238 average annual salary of an operations inspector.
The top three skills for an inspector general include IG, OIG and DOD. The most important skills for an operations inspector are safety procedures, GMP, and quality standards.
